| App name | GLPzy |
|---|---|
| Platform | iPhone and iPad |
| Category | Private GLP-1 tracking app |
| Tracks | doses, dose reminders, injection sites, weight, symptoms, appetite, nutrition, notes, progress photos, optional read-only Apple Health context |
| Account requirement | No mandatory in-app account is required for core tracking. |
| Privacy posture | Local-first. Records stay on the device unless the user exports, shares or restores a local backup. |
| Apple Health scope | Apple Health support is optional and read-only. With permission, GLPzy can read weight, height, glucose, body composition, movement, workouts and nutrition context. GLPzy does not write data back to Apple Health. |
| Export formats | CSV and JSON for core records. Premium adds deeper summaries and clinician-ready PDF summaries. |
| Medical boundary | Personal tracking only. GLPzy is not medical advice, not a dosing guide, not a medical device and not a substitute for a qualified clinician. |
